SVLDRS - Since the petitioner has already made payment of the amount in respect of which, he had claimed the benefit under the SVLDRS scheme much prior to submitting Form SVLDRS-1, the petitioner would be entitled to avail the benefit under the SVLDRS Scheme and rejection of the same by the respondents by issuing the impugned communication is clearly arbitrary, illegal and contrary to law - HC
